The total number of parking lot spaces to configure. Example, if 70 is the extension and 8 slots are configured, the parking slots will be 71-78. Users can transfer a call directly into a parking slot.

Where to send a parked call that has timed out. If set to yes then the parked call will be sent back to the originating device that sent the call to this parking lot. If the origin is busy then we will send the call to the Destination selected below. If set to no then we will send the call directly to the destination selected below

You can also transfer directly to a lot number (71 through 78) and if that lot is empty, your call will be parked there
|
Medium |
|
|
|
|
You can transfer a call to the Parking Lot Extension (70 by default), the call will then be placed into a lot (71-78 by default) and the lot number will be announced to you.
